Substack logo

Full-Stack Engineer, Core Product Team

Substack

Full-Stack Engineer, Core Product Team

About the Role

As a Full-Stack Engineer on the Core Product Team at Substack, you will be at the forefront of developing our core product platform. This role involves working on everything from frontend UI and testing to APIs, low-level services, and database operations. You will collaborate closely with designers, product thinkers, and directly with customers to build new product offerings and tools across the platform.

Responsibilities

  • Develop the core Substack product for readers and writers with the support of the engineering team.
  • Engage in a dynamic organization with needs across the board, jumping into any area of the product, learning quickly, and adding value.
  • Grow and learn engineering best practices with close mentorship and collaboration from more experienced engineers.
  • Contribute to the entire product process in collaboration with designers, writers, support staff, and others, from product concept and research to implementation and deployment.
  • Work directly with customers to solve their problems, participating in customer support to build empathy and help build better products.

Technologies We Use

  • JavaScript, especially Node/Express and React
  • Postgres

Requirements

  • 3+ years of non-internship professional front-end web software development using TypeScript and React.js.
  • A degree in Computer Science or equivalent industry experience.
  • Independent and autonomous work style, with the ability to own your work and be a leader.
  • Pride in building elegant and delightful product experiences.
  • Enjoy collaboration with a diverse group of thinkers while bringing your own unique experience and background to the team.
  • Belief in Substack's mission to build a better business model for writing.

Compensation and Benefits

  • Market competitive salary
  • Equity for all full-time roles
  • Exceptional benefits

About Substack

Substack lets writers connect with their audience on their own terms and earn money doing it. We make it simple for writers to publish to an email list that they own, get discovered on the web, and charge for subscriptions. More than 500,000 people pay to subscribe to writers across the Substack network, and the top writers make millions of dollars a year. Substack’s model depends on the success of writers using Substack – we only make money when they do.

We are a small but growing team, and there is more to build than we could ever imagine. That’s why we need you. We aim to take pragmatic approaches to problem-solving while shipping high-quality products that allow the writing on Substack to take the spotlight.

We believe that a diverse team will help us build a product that best serves the needs of a wildly diverse ecosystem of writers. So whatever your background or perspective, we’d welcome your input to help build the best possible version of Substack.

Benefits
Extracted with AI

  • Market competitive salary
  • Equity for all full-time roles
  • Exceptional benefits

Similar jobs

Last update: 23 minutes ago

Substack logo
Substack

Full-Stack Engineer with React.js and TypeScript

Join Substack as a Full-Stack Engineer to develop core products using React.js and TypeScript. Remote work with competitive salary and benefits.

Substack logo
Substack

Senior Software Engineer, Substack Enterprise

Join Substack as a Senior Software Engineer to develop core products using JavaScript, Node, React, and Postgres. Remote work available.

Substack logo
Substack

Senior Software Engineer, Core Product Team

Join Substack as a Senior Software Engineer to develop core products using JavaScript, Node.js, React, and Postgres.

Meetsta logo
Meetsta

Full Stack Developer (Founding Engineer)

Join Meetsta as a Full Stack Developer (Founding Engineer) to build innovative social networking solutions using React, Node.js, and TypeScript.

Meetsta logo
Meetsta

Full Stack Developer (Founding Engineer) with gRPC Expertise

Join Meetsta as a Full Stack Developer with gRPC expertise. Work remotely to build innovative social networking solutions.

Meetsta logo
Meetsta

Full Stack Developer with gRPC Expertise (Founding Engineer)

Join Meetsta as a Full Stack Developer with gRPC expertise. Work remotely to build innovative social networking solutions.

Postscript logo
Postscript

Staff Fullstack Engineer (JavaScript, Node.js, TypeScript)

Join Postscript as a Staff Fullstack Engineer to design scalable systems using JavaScript, Node.js, and TypeScript in a remote role.

Snappy logo
Snappy

Full Stack Engineer with JavaScript and React.js

Join Snappy as a Full Stack Engineer to build next-gen gifting platforms using JavaScript and React.js. Remote work available in Austin, TX.

Atlassian logo
Atlassian

Full Stack Software Engineer

Join Atlassian as a Full Stack Software Engineer, working remotely to build innovative solutions with JavaScript, React, and Node.js.

Apollo GraphQL logo
Apollo GraphQL

Senior Full-Stack Product Engineer

Join Apollo GraphQL as a Senior Full-Stack Product Engineer, working remotely to build and optimize GraphQL tools.

Messari logo
Messari

Senior Full Stack Engineer with React and TypeScript

Join Messari as a Senior Full Stack Engineer focusing on React and TypeScript to build scalable web applications.

Scopic logo
Scopic

Full-stack JavaScript Developer

Join Scopic's Talent Community for Full-stack JavaScript Developers. Gain priority access to future opportunities in a remote setting.

Trunk Tools logo
Trunk Tools

Full Stack Engineer with React.js and TypeScript

Join Trunk Tools as a Full Stack Engineer to revolutionize construction with React.js and TypeScript. Remote work available.

Postscript logo
Postscript

Staff Fullstack Engineer (JavaScript, Node.js, TypeScript)

Join Postscript as a Staff Fullstack Engineer to design scalable microservices in a remote role. Competitive salary and equity offered.

Layr logo
Layr

Senior Full Stack Engineer

Join Layr as a Senior Full Stack Engineer to develop cloud-hosted web applications using JavaScript, Node.js, TypeScript, and React.

Softrams logo
Softrams

Mid-Level Full Stack Developer (Angular, React, NodeJS)

Join Softrams as a Mid-Level Full Stack Developer specializing in Angular, React, and NodeJS for remote work in the US.

Human Interest logo
Human Interest

Senior Full-Stack Software Engineer

Join Human Interest as a Senior Full-Stack Software Engineer to build world-class customer experiences in a remote role.

Doktor.se logo
Doktor.se

Fullstack Developer with React and Node.js

Join Doktor.se as a Fullstack Developer to revolutionize healthcare with React, Node.js, and AWS.

NVIDIA logo
NVIDIA

Senior Full Stack Web Software Engineer

Join NVIDIA as a Senior Full Stack Web Software Engineer to build AI-assisted developer tools using React.js and TypeScript.

Revv logo
Revv

Senior Full Stack Engineer

Join Revv as a Senior Full Stack Engineer to lead innovative software solutions in the automotive industry using Node.js, React, and TypeScript.

banQi logo
banQi

Full Stack Software Engineering Specialist (Node/React)

Join banQi as a Full Stack Software Engineering Specialist, working with Node.js and React Native in a dynamic environment.

SpaceX logo
SpaceX

Full Stack Software Engineer (Starlink)

Join SpaceX as a Full Stack Software Engineer for Starlink, working on cutting-edge satellite internet technology.

Aavu logo
Aavu

Full Stack Developer with Node.js and React.js

Join Aavu as a Full Stack Developer in Turku, focusing on Node.js and React.js for subscription-based solutions.

Axiom World logo
Axiom World

MERN Full Stack Developer

Join our team as a MERN Full Stack Developer. Work on innovative projects using MongoDB, Express.js, React.js, and Node.js.